On Monday, US Vice President Mike Pence used a visit to Panmunjom, the heavily militarized border between the two Koreas Monday, to declare "all options are on the table" in dealing with Pyongyang, the day after the North's latest failed missile test. "North Korea would do well not to test his resolve or the strength of the armed forces of the United States in this region". It is being urged by the Trump administration to do more to rein in the North's missile and nuclear weapons programmes.
Pence reiterated the Trump administration position that the "era of strategic patience is over", referencing the policy of prior administrations that attempted to impose crippling economic sanctions on the isolated nation with the view that it would eventually be in a state of economic disaster and be forced to negotiate.
"The era of strategic patience is over".
"We seek peace always as a country, as does Japan, but as you know and the United States knows, peace comes through strength and we will stand strongly with Japan and strongly with our allies for a peace and security in this region", Pence added.
North Korea rolled out a collection of new missiles over the weekend, including several intercontinental ballistic missile models.
